Why AI matters at this scale

Cherry Creek School District is a large public K-12 district serving over 50,000 students across the Denver metropolitan area. As a major suburban district with a 5,001-10,000 employee size band, it operates a complex ecosystem of schools, transportation, food services, and administrative functions. Its core mission is to provide a comprehensive and equitable education that prepares all students for post-secondary success. At this scale, even minor improvements in operational efficiency or student outcomes can have a massive aggregate impact, affecting tens of thousands of families and involving a budget approaching a billion dollars.

For a district of this size, AI is not a futuristic concept but a practical tool to address persistent challenges. The sheer volume of students creates vast amounts of data on attendance, assessment, and behavior—data that is often underutilized. AI can analyze these patterns to move from reactive to proactive support. Furthermore, the district's operational complexity, from bus routing to substitute teacher placement, consumes significant resources that could be redirected to the classroom. AI offers a path to automate routine tasks, optimize logistics, and provide hyper-personalized learning pathways that would be impossible for human staff to manage manually across such a large population. The imperative is to leverage technology to fulfill the district's mission more effectively and equitably.

Concrete AI Opportunities with ROI Framing

1. Personalized Learning & Intervention: Implementing AI-driven adaptive learning platforms represents the highest-impact opportunity. These systems adjust instructional content in real time based on student performance, providing targeted practice and scaffolding. For a district with diverse learners, this can help close achievement gaps at scale. The ROI is measured in improved standardized test scores, higher graduation rates, and reduced need for costly remedial summer school or tutoring programs, directly impacting state funding and long-term student success.

2. Operational & Administrative Efficiency: AI can automate high-volume, repetitive administrative tasks. Natural language processing can draft individualized education program (IEP) documents based on specialist notes, saving hundreds of hours. Machine learning can optimize bus routes for fuel efficiency and timely arrivals, and forecast staffing needs. The direct ROI is financial, freeing up budget from operational overhead and reducing overtime, while the indirect ROI comes from improved staff morale and focus on student-facing duties.

3. Enhanced Family & Community Engagement: Deploying AI-powered multilingual communication tools can translate district updates, teacher comments, and assignment details for non-English speaking families in real time. Chatbots can handle routine inquiries about schedules, lunches, or events, freeing up front-office staff. The ROI here is profound but less quantifiable: increased family involvement, stronger community trust, and more inclusive school culture, which are foundational to student well-being and performance.

Deployment Risks Specific to This Size Band

Deploying AI in a large public school district carries unique risks. First is data privacy and security: managing sensitive student data (protected by FERPA and COPPA) across dozens of schools and thousands of devices requires robust governance, or the district risks catastrophic breaches and loss of public trust. Second is algorithmic bias and equity: AI models trained on historical data can perpetuate existing disparities. A district serving a diverse population must rigorously audit tools for fairness across racial, socioeconomic, and disability status lines. Third is change management and training: rolling out new technologies to over 5,000 staff members requires immense investment in professional development. Without buy-in from teachers and administrators, even the best tools will fail. Finally, budget cycles and procurement in public education are slow and politically sensitive, making it difficult to pilot innovative solutions quickly and requiring clear, demonstrable ROI to secure funding.

Frequently asked

Common questions about AI for k-12 public education

How can AI help with teacher shortages?
AI cannot replace teachers but can act as a force multiplier—automating grading, providing lesson plan suggestions, and offering 24/7 tutoring support to ease workload and focus human interaction on complex student needs.
What are the biggest data privacy concerns?
Using student data for AI requires strict FERPA/COPPA compliance. A key risk is data breaches or biased algorithms. Success depends on transparent data governance, anonymization, and involving parents in the conversation.
Is AI cost-effective for a public school district?
Initial investment is a hurdle, but ROI comes from operational efficiencies (reduced administrative overtime), improved student outcomes (funding tied to performance), and preventing costly interventions later via early AI-driven support.
How can we ensure AI tools are equitable?
Require vendor algorithms to be audited for bias, ensure tools are accessible to students with disabilities and low connectivity, and continuously monitor impact across different demographic groups within the district.
